The Bella Vista Village Property Owners Association (BVVPOA) requested that the Watershed Conservation Resource Center (WCRC) develop a basic plan to address accumulated gravels that have deposited within an impacted reach of Blowing Springs Creek located at the Blowing Springs RV Park. Significant flooding that occurred in the spring and summer of 2013 resulted in the accumulation of gravels within the stream channel, significantly reducing the capacity of the stream to transport flows without overtopping the channel and flooding an adjacent roadway.
The creek is fed by Blowing Springs which provides base flow year-round. During storm events, most flow is generated by runoff from the adjacent landscape, which is composed of steep, rocky hillsides and somewhat broad valley. The prescribed actions will restore the capacity of the impacted stream reach thus preventing inundation of the adjacent roadway. This will reduce the risk of safety hazards to motorists and the roadway. Long term maintenance of the channel will likely be required as large-magnitude flood events will inevitably occur in the future and the movement of bedload during these types of events cannot be accurately predicted or adequately prepared for.
